E-readers are nothing new, but Sony stepped it up today with the introduction of the touchscreen PRS-700. Sporting similar dimensions and svelteness of the original Sony e-reader, the PRS-700′s 6-inch screen allows readers to intuitively flip through a book, magazine or newspaper by sliding their finger across the screen. Happen across an interesting article? No problem, just call up the virtual keyboard or use the stylus to jot a note. They’ve also tossed in a bed partner friendly LED reading light for night time witch stories. Total memory has been bumped allowing for up to 350 e-books, which is further expandable via SD or Memory Stick duo cards.
